Most a short while ago, it's been identified that conolidine and the above mentioned derivatives act about the atypical chemokine receptor 3 (ACKR3. Expressed in equivalent parts as classical opioid receptors, it binds to the wide array of endogenous opioids. As opposed to most opioid receptors, this receptor acts as being a scavenger and won't activate a 2nd messenger process (fifty nine). As talked about by Meyrath et al., this also indicated a feasible connection among these receptors and also the endogenous opiate system (fifty nine). This review in the end established which the ACKR3 receptor didn't deliver any G protein signal response by measuring and acquiring no mini G protein interactions, as opposed to classical opiate receptors, which recruit these proteins for signaling.

This compound was also analyzed for mu-opioid receptor action, and like conolidine, was discovered to have no exercise at the internet site. Using the same paw injection exam, several options with greater efficacy have been discovered that inhibited the Original pain reaction, indicating opiate-like exercise. Offered the different mechanisms of these conolidine derivatives, it absolutely was also suspected that they would supply this analgesic outcome without having mimicking opiate Unwanted side effects (63). The same team synthesized added conolidine derivatives, locating a further compound often called 15a that experienced very similar Attributes and did not bind the mu-opioid receptor (sixty six).
We demonstrated that, in contrast to classical opioid receptors, ACKR3 would not result in classical G protein signaling and is not modulated via the classical prescription or analgesic opioids, for example mor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ists for example naloxone. Instead, we set up that LIH383, an ACKR3-selective subnanomolar competitor peptide, helps prevent ACKR3’s negative regulatory function on opioid peptides within an ex vivo rat Mind design and potentiates their action toward classical opioid receptors.

The atypical chemokine receptor ACKR3 has recently been noted to work as an opioid scavenger with exclusive damaging regulatory properties in the direction of various people of opioid peptides.
Though it really is unfamiliar regardless of whether other unidentified interactions are taking place at the receptor that lead to its consequences, the receptor plays a task as being a detrimental down regulator of endogenous opiate levels by way of scavenging activity. This drug-receptor interaction features an alternative choice to manipulation of your classical opiate pathway.
Gene expression Assessment uncovered that ACKR3 is very expressed in various brain areas akin to crucial opioid action facilities. Additionally, its expression amounts are frequently higher than Those people of classical opioid receptors, which even more supports the physiological relevance of its observed in vitro opioid peptide scavenging capability.
